Digicheck is the only RME software that you can use without hardware.
But only on windows computer, no macs, and you must use an ASIO driver.
The problem is, Digicheck uses audio input channels.
And your software plays sound that goes only to output channels.
you need an aditional software that gives you a Loopback function for routing the output channel into an input channel.

Sib. 7.1: ASIO4ALL Driver
Posted by barb4543 - 16 Mar 03:10AM Hide picture Avid recommends the ASIO4All Driver as good low latency driver. Cannot get it to work in Sibelius 7. It shows up as available in the Audio Engine Options window, but cannot get any sound. Anybody had this problem ? How did you resolve ? I'm running Win 7 Prof. 32 bit. DAW is DIGI 003 with PT-9.0.6 Back to top Allthreads Re: Sib. 7.1: ASIO4ALL Driver
Posted by Laurence Payne - 16 Mar 03:19AM Hide picture In Audio Engine Options there will be a choice of outputs - 1/2, 3/4, maybe 5/6. Try them all.

ALso, make sure there is no other audio application running as well as Sibelius that might have grabbed the ASIO4ALL device for itself! Back to top Allthreads Re: Sib. 7.1: ASIO4ALL Driver
Posted by Andy G - 16 Mar 07:18AM Hide picture ASIO4ALL is not a driver, it's a 'wrapper' for non-ASIO capable systems. Why are you trying to use ASIO4ALL when the Digi has its own proper ASIO drivers?

Posted by Laurence Payne - 16 Mar 10:31AM Hide picture Very good point! ASIO4ALL is better than no ASIO driver (the situation with a computer's on-board sound chip) but no competition for a quality soundcard with it's own driver. Back to top Allthreads Re: Sib. 7.1: ASIO4ALL Driver
Posted by Robin Walker - 16 Mar 11:04AM Hide picture ASIO4ALL will go silent without any diagnostic if it is unable to use the output device selected within the ASIO4ALL setup panel.

So the first thing to do is open ASIO4ALL setup, and configure it to use the physical output devices that you wish it to use, in the advanced settings.

ASIO4ALL will fail silently if the selected output device is in use by any other audio application.

Any adjustments you make to ASIO4ALL settings will not take effect within Sibelius until the next time that Sibelius initialises the audio output engine: one way of forcing this is to quit and re-launch Sibelius. Another way is to change Sibelius's Audio Engine Options to a non-ASIO selection, and then change them back to ASIO4ALL.

Posted by barb4543 - 17 Mar 05:39PM Hide picture To all that replied to use the 003 ASIO, I understand that the 003 has its own ASIO driver. Reason I'm looking for an alternate ASIO to use in SIB is to be able to add lyrics and some arranging tweaks to a PT Score Editor file I've sent to SIB while having PT open also so I can listen/refer back to instrumentals in the PT file. You can't do this if the 2 are re-wired - - you can only listen to the complete audio, not the separate vocals in SIB and the instrumentals in PT.

Whenever PT is open it grabs the 003 ASIO and I'm left with only some poor high latency driver choices in SIB that makes arranging a real challenge. Back to top Allthreads Re: Sib. 7.1: ASIO4ALL Driver
Posted by Robin Walker - 17 Mar 07:00PM Hide picture You cannot do that. ASIO4ALL demands that it has exclusive use of the chosen output device, which it cannot get if you have the same output device open in PT.

Posted by Daniel Spreadbury - 20 Mar 09:11AM Hide picture Unfortunately you would need a device with multi-client ASIO support in order to have low-latency playback in both Sibelius and Pro Tools simultaneously.

I got digi 001 running on windows 7...
i left my xp on hard disk while installing win 7. it kept xp on folder windows.old folder. in control panel i saw digi as multimedia adapter wich system couldn't recognice. hit "change settings" -> driver -> update driver
used my old windows to search for driver. it found "Dalvin.sys" driver for adapter. installed that. after that windows recogniced digi 001.
downloaded "digidesign asio 6.11" driver installer for win-xp and ran it.
and bingo - it works!
in every step windows was complaining and asking do i want to do this. just yeah'd everything. as i just had a clean install of win 7 i just thought whatta heck i can install everything again if it would not work, but it did.

so in a nut shell:
1: install Dalvin.sys in control panel for digi 001
2: run digidesign asio 6.11 driver installer for win-xp

for me it worked but i absolutely take no responsibility if you mess your system with this! at least reaper got a sound out of it. i haven't tried to record anything yet. but asio settings seemed to work as they used to do in xp.
